you should read the readme...

To install:
Unzip entire contents into a directory.

Place YOUR Heretic Wad in that directory and make sure it is called Heretic.wad
NOTE: The shareware wad is named Heretic1.wad. You must rename it (or edit the "make_hereticfs.bat" file).

Unzip gbfs into the directory

Execute "make_dsHeretic.bat"
This will create dsHeretic.ds.gba

Flash dsHeretic.ds.gba onto your gba cart

Run it using PassMe/Wifime/FlashMe

Enjoy!

to add music you need the raw files which are hosted on the homepage. http://heretic.drunkencoders.com/Heretic%20music.zip

For music:
Download the Heretic music from http://heretic.drunkencoders.com.

Unzip the .raw music files into your dsHeretic directory.

Execute "make_dsHeretic_with_music.bat"
This will create dsHeretic.ds.gba

you need a retail wad or shareware wad, as one is not included with the download.

i was sucessful with renaming the file to .nds and running on my m3 lite. other wise if that fails you need a slot2 flash kit. just so you know the compiled file is too large for a 3-in-1, its 33.8mb. also the game is older using old fat code, so sram dumps can be troublesome for some kits. saves on my m3 lite only work until i overwrite the sram. dumping it doesn't do anything. finally its a dead project, updates aren't planned or to be expected.

I'm curious, does the shareware wad limit the DS version to shareware content only? Or will you get the full game anyway?

EDIT I can run it in the DS emulator, but not on my DSTT. It just loads halfway then stalls.

shareware wads are not complete, there is no way to unlock them. you would have to physically try to merge the missing content from a retail wad using a wad editor. i can't help debug a dstt i don't own one.

i run it renamed to .nds on my slot2 in ds mode using my r4 as a passme device. it isn't an emulator but a port of the game engine itself to run on the nds on a slot2 card in ds mode. its an older project that hasn't been updated to include slot1 kits or dldi, for example. afaik it can't *require* a slot2 for anything because it should be on a slot2. what i mean is there won't be code that when its on the slot1 its looking for a slot2 kit or ram or something.

If you knew anything about the history of homebrew on the DS, you'd know that before SLOT-1 cards existed, all homebrew had to be run from SLOT-2 using a PassMe device in SLOT-1 (or FlashMe) to trick the DS into thinking it was running from SLOT-1. They don't "have a hard-on" for running stuff from SLOT-2, it's just an older project which uses the only method of running homebrew which existed at the time of its release.
